<h3>
  Paper Plate Umbrella<br>
</h3>
<p>
  Estimated time: 20-30 minutes. This simple craft uses readily available materials to create a charming umbrella. Children can decorate the umbrella with markers, crayons, or paint, fostering creativity and self-expression.
</p>
<ol>
<li>Gather a paper plate, paint, markers, scissors, and glue.
  </li>
<li>Paint the paper plate in desired colors.
  </li>
<li>Once dry, cut out a semi-circle from the top edge of the paper plate, creating the umbrella&rsquo;s shape.
  </li>
<li>Add decorative elements, like stripes or patterns, using markers.
  </li>
<li>Attach a small handle made from construction paper or a stick.
  </li>
</ol>
<h3>
  Construction Paper Umbrella<br>
</h3>
<div class="internal-linking-related-contents"><a href="https://neutronnuggets.com/birthday-present-craft-ideas/" class="template-2" data-wpel-link="internal" target="_self" rel="follow noopener noreferrer"><span class="cta">Related Content</span><span class="postTitle">Amazing Birthday Present Craft Ideas</span></a></div><p>
  Estimated time: 30-40 minutes. This craft allows for exploration of color and pattern manipulation in a relatively free-form process. This simple project emphasizes creativity and fine motor skill development.
</p>
<ol>
<li>Gather construction paper, scissors, glue, and optional embellishments.
  </li>
<li>Cut out a semi-circle shape from the construction paper.
  </li>
<li>Cut fringe along the semi-circle edge to create the umbrellas appearance.
  </li>
<li>Decorate with stickers, glitter, or markers.
  </li>
<li>Attach a small handle using glue.
  </li>
</ol>
<h3>
  Handprint Umbrella<br>
</h3>
<p>
  Estimated time: 25-35 minutes. This craft captures the children&rsquo;s handprints, adding a personal touch. This technique encourages exploration of color mixing while highlighting their individual unique hand shapes.
</p>
<ol>
<li>Gather paint, paper, a handle (stick or construction paper), and a sponge.
  </li>
<li>Paint the childs hand and press onto the paper.
  </li>
<li>Repeat with different colors to add variety. Let dry completely.
  </li>
<li>Once dry, draw the umbrella&rsquo;s shape around the handprints.
  </li>
<li>Glue or tape the handle onto the finished umbrella.
  </li>
</ol>
<h3>
  Coffee Filter Umbrella<br>
</h3>
<p>
  Estimated time: 30-40 minutes. This craft introduces watercolors in a unique and engaging way. The coffee filters act as a canvas allowing for interesting color blending and experimentation.
</p>
<ol>
<li>Gather coffee filters, watercolors, spray bottle, and a handle (stick or construction paper).
  </li>
<li>Spray the coffee filters with water and apply watercolor paints.
  </li>
<li>Allow to dry completely.
  </li>
<li>Once dry, carefully shape the coffee filter into an umbrella form.
  </li>
<li>Attach a handle using glue or tape.
  </li>
</ol>

<p><b>How can I adapt these crafts for children with different abilities?</b></p>
<p>
  Adaptations can include pre-cutting shapes, providing larger or easier-to-grip tools, offering alternative techniques (like painting with sponges), or simplifying the steps. Consider the individual child&rsquo;s abilities and provide support as needed. Remember, the focus should be on participation and enjoyment.

<h3>
  Paper Plate Umbrella<br>
</h3>
<p>
  (Estimated time: 20-30 minutes) This simple craft utilizes readily available materials to create a charming umbrella. Children will develop fine motor skills through cutting, gluing, and decorating.
</p>
<ol>
<li>Cut a circle from a paper plate.
  </li>
<li>Cut a slit from the edge of the circle to the center, creating a spiral shape.
  </li>
<li>Roll the spiral into a cone shape, securing with glue.
  </li>
<li>Decorate the paper plate umbrella with crayons, markers, or paint.
  </li>
<li>Add a small handle made from pipe cleaners or construction paper.
  </li>
</ol>
